nsFuses for public distribution Special size 2 gG fuses from 63 to 400 A
Function
Advantages
SOCOMEC fuses provide protection for low voltage distribution wiring systems. They are intended for section feeders on low voltage switchboards, high power circuits, and with network boxes and connection enclosures.
There are 2 versions of fuses: • 115 mm bar with flexible clamp. • 160 mm bar with secure clamp.
In addition to the fuses, a neutral link should be fitted to the neutral pole of the circuit breakers.
In addition to the benefits of standard gG fuses (high breaking capacity, simple and reliable discrimination, guaranteed protection over time, arc containment inside the fuse during fault elimination, etc.), these fuses have extra benefits.
Improved mechanical withstandSOCOMEC fuses can withstand a drop of one metre on any angle without breaking or bending out of shape. The impact resistance is 3 joules, as per standard HN 63-S-20. For this, the fuses have patented insulating gripping lugs and an insulating polyester casing. IP2XCIts IP2X protection index considerably enhances operator safety. Apart from the blades that project on either side of the fuse casing, the entire fuse is made of insulating material, including the gripping lugs. Once in place, this type of fuse ensures the IP2XC protection level for equipment, for example the TIPI low voltage feeder pillar
Optimum quality Product quality and traceability are ensured by an individual test and quality-control marking at the end of production.
Adapted protectionWith a slightly different curve compared to a gG fuse, a HN fuse provides better protection for low overcurrents that occur especially in case of short circuit impedance (e.g. a fault on a long section of cable). See the characteristics below.
Certified low watt loss Consumption for each rating is limited by standard HN 63-S-20, thus reducing operating costs.

HN fuse melting times are very similar to gG fuses for high overcurrents (20 In and over), but slightly quicker for overcurrents from 2.5 to 6 In.
